Hymera Indiana BEACHES & WATERFRONT ESCAPES
Listed below are the best beaches and waterfront escapes near Hymera, Indiana.
1. Sullivan County Park & Lake
Expansive lakeside retreat. Stretch out on a sandy beach or swim in the large designated swimming area at this scenic 461-acre lake park. Enjoy a lively lineup of recreational options including boating, fishing, lakeside picnicking, disc golf, and family-friendly playgrounds.
